Career Role (IIoT Specialist) Description
IIoT Consultant (Industrial IoT) Designs, implements, and manages Industrial Internet of Things (IIoT) solutions for diverse industries. Strong problem-solving skills and knowledge of various IIoT protocols are crucial.
IIoT Data Scientist (Data Analytics) Analyzes large datasets generated by IIoT devices, identifying trends and insights to optimize processes and predict failures. Expertise in statistical modeling and data visualization is essential.
IIoT Systems Engineer (Cloud Computing) Develops and maintains IIoT infrastructure, integrating various hardware and software components into robust cloud-based systems. Familiarity with cloud platforms like AWS or Azure is highly valuable.
IIoT Security Analyst (Cybersecurity) Focuses on securing IIoT networks and devices against cyber threats. Requires in-depth knowledge of cybersecurity best practices and experience in vulnerability management.
